 > I sent an email about problems with my users reaching my SMTP server via
 > Earthlink dialup. Several responded and from that I found that Earthlink
 > was blocking SMTP except to their mail server.
 > 
 > My immediate idea for a solution was to run a second qmail-smtpd on
 > another port that Earthlink is not blocking. My question is, can I run
 > multiple instances of qmail-smtpd concurrently on different ports
 > through supervise and tcpserver, or do I need to do something wierd to
 > make this work?

You can run multiple instances on different ports without any trouble;
you give tcpserver the port to run on as a command-line argument.
